Output d952cabcb62ca4675083ecc574ec7669fe4e8c2bd9489448fe8c6ee45a118429:0

value
34409447
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b32198a05fe0f01e2044338408f158a04cc0b66 OP_EQUALVERIFY OP_CHECKSIG
address
17rbhP2dF9Ao8g87BAjKVzhwBUpHCo4nh6
transaction
d952cabcb62ca4675083ecc574ec7669fe4e8c2bd9489448fe8c6ee45a118429
spent
true